Last Minute DIY Gifts (Herb Salt and Spiced Sugar)

Cute little four-ounce jars of herb salt and/or spiced sugar make terrific, inexpensive last-minute DIY gifts for the holidays, or really any time. Here's how to make them.

Instructions

  • Fill each jar with about six heaping tablespoons of either herb salt or spiced sugar.
  • Print labels, above, onto label sheets. It's a good idea to test your printer first on a plain piece of paper and then hold that paper up to the light with a sheet of labels behind it to check for alignment. Make sure to print at 100%, not "fit to page."
  • Adhere a label onto the flat insert on each jar lid.
  • Screw lids onto jars and gift away. Salt and sugar keep well for at least a year.

Notes

  1. The herb salt is very versatile. Try sprinkling it over everything from avocado toast to potatoes to risotto to roast chicken.
  2. The spiced sugar is great in coffee, tea, oatmeal, and more.
  3. Both the herb salt and the spiced sugar will keep well in their airtight containers at room temperature for at least a year. I like that their long shelf life makes them a low-pressure gift.
